How to Choose the Right Portable Document Scanner

The best document scanner depends on how your business handles paperwork. If your office scans dozens of documents every day, prioritize models with fast duplex scanning, a reliable automatic document feeder, and software that integrates with cloud storage or document management platforms. These features reduce manual work and improve overall productivity.

Businesses that frequently work outside the office should instead focus on portability. Lightweight scanners with built-in batteries and wireless connectivity allow documents to be digitized immediately after client meetings, property inspections, or business travel. This helps eliminate paperwork delays and reduces the risk of losing important documents.

Finally, consider your primary document type. General office scanners work well for contracts and forms, while specialized receipt scanners simplify bookkeeping and tax preparation. Investing in a scanner designed for your workflow will deliver greater efficiency than simply choosing the fastest model available.

3. Can document scanners convert paper into searchable PDFs?

Yes. Most modern business scanners include OCR (Optical Character Recognition), allowing scanned documents to become searchable and editable.
